How can I speak confidently without fear?

Practicing tips:Don’t just read the presentation through – practice everything, including your transitions and using your visual aids.Stand up and speak it aloud as though you were presenting to an audience.Ensure that you practice your body language and gesturing.Practice in front of others and get their feedback.

What is an example of self confidence?

Self-confidence is a person’s belief or trust in their own ability. An example of self-confidence is a guitarist knowing they’re able to play a particular song really well. Confidence in oneself or one’s own abilities.
